The Ongwediva College of Education (OCE) was one of four universities of teacher education in Namibia and offered three-year diploma courses in basic vocational education for blind primary and secondary school teachers : the Basic Education Teacher Diploma (BETD).
The university was based in the town of Ongwediva near Oshakati and was founded in 1913 by Finnish missionaries. In addition to teaching rooms, it also maintained a university library, a computer and art center, and student dormitories.
Effective April 1, 2010, the college was incorporated into the Faculty of Education at the University of Namibia .
